Comprehending the Sofa Sale Market

Sofa sales take place throughout the year, however they tend to peak during particular times-- normally during vacation weekends, end-of-season events, and clearance durations. Merchants typically discount sofas to give way for brand-new designs or throughout significant shopping occasions like Black Friday, Valentine's Day, Memorial Day, and Labor Day.

Secret Factors Influencing Sofa Sales:

  1. Seasonal Trends: Furniture merchants typically align their sales with seasonal preferences. For instance, lighter materials might go on sale in late winter season, clearing space for much heavier fabrics appropriate for colder months.
  2. New Arrivals: When brand-new stock gets here, retailers typically introduce sales on the previous year's models to make room.
  3. Clearance Events: Stores may hold inventory-clearance sale to lower stock before renovations or shop movings.

Kinds of Sofas on Sale

When shopping for a sofa, comprehending the numerous types available can help a purchaser make an informed choice. Each style has unique attributes, which can affect both convenience and aesthetic appeal.

Common Sofa Styles:

  • Sectional Sofas: These pieces are flexible and can be set up in various setups to fit various room designs.
  • Sleeper Sofas: Ideal for small areas, these sofas can transform into beds for visitors.
  • Chesterfield Sofas: Known for their deep button tufting and rolled arms, they add a touch of sophistication to standard settings.
  • Mid-Century Modern Sofas: These sofas show the minimalist trends of the mid-20th century with clean lines and simple forms.
  • Spending plan Sofas: Generally, these are made from less costly products but can still use a stylish look and convenience for transient home.

Tips for Scoring the very best Deals

Before You Shop: Research and Planning

  • Know Your Budget: Determine just how much you are ready to spend. This can help you limit your alternatives quickly.
  • Procedure Your Space: Before heading out, determine the area where the sofa will sit. Don't forget to represent entrances and elevators!

Throughout the Sale: Smart Shopping Strategies

  1. Sign Up for Newsletters: Many furniture stores offer special discounts to their customers.
  2. Shop Early: Arriving early during sales can give you initially dibs on popular products before they sell out.
  3. Examine the Quality: Check materials and building and construction; decide for sofas with sturdy frames and high-density foam for sturdiness.
  4. Work out: In numerous cases, there is room for negotiation. Do not be reluctant to ask for extra discounts or complimentary shipment.

After Your Purchase: Delivery and Care

  • Check upon Delivery: Ensure that the sofa has actually not been harmed during transport.
  • Read Care Instructions: Different fabrics need different care approaches. Familiarize yourself with how to keep your sofa's appearance and longevity.

FAQs About Sofa Sales

1. When is the very best time to purchase a sofa?

The very best times to buy a sofa include significant vacations (such as Labor Day, Memorial Day, and Black Friday) and completion of the winter season when merchants clear out inventory.

2. How can I tell if a sofa is the right size for my room?

Usage painter's tape to lay out the measurements of the sofa on your floor. This will help visualize just how much space the sofa will inhabit.

3. What is the typical life expectancy of a sofa?

A sound sofa can last anywhere from 7 to 15 years, depending on the quality of materials, usage, and care.

4. Are there warranties on sofas bought throughout sales?

Most merchants provide guarantees regardless of sale status. Be sure to ask about warranty information before purchasing.

5. Can I return a sofa if it does not suit my area?

Return policies vary by retailer. Always check the shop's return policies before buying, especially with larger furniture items like sofas.
